About this experience
Enjoy an unique experience in winter wonderland! Spend the night in our special cabin that offers breathtaking view from your room. Stay warm under your blanket and observe the northern lights and stars from the bed on a clear sky night. You can use also the traditional wooden sauna inside the cabin to add a touch of relaxation. This can be your combination of aurora & sauna experience in the arctic on the same night. Use also our outdoor fireplace to warm up!
